What Is Consumer Fraud Law?
Consumer fraud refers to the use of deceptive business practices that cost consumers money. This can include:
- Bait-and-switch scams
- False advertising
- Identity theft
- Telemarketing scams
- Phishing scams
- Selling knowingly defective products
Fraud is against the law. In addition to criminal charges, you can take legal action to protect your finances.
What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need a Consumer Fraud Lawyer?
If you think you have been the victim of consumer fraud, you should contact an attorney today. Some examples include:
- A car dealer promoted a sale on a certain vehicle only to offer something different when you showed up
- A business used your personal information to open a line of credit after a credit card transaction
- You bought a product on the condition that it could perform a function that it couldn’t because of advertising claims

What Questions Should I Ask When Trying To Find a Consumer Protection Lawyer in Running Springs?
These questions can help you decide if you feel comfortable and confident that a lawyer has the qualifications, experience, and ability to manage your case. Many consumer protection lawyers offer an initial consultation that allows you to understand your options and get specific legal advice before hiring them. The top questions include:
- What is your experience in handling consumer protection cases in California?
- Have you represented consumers in cases like mine?
- What are potential issues that can come up during consumer protection cases?
- How will you keep me informed about updates in my case?
- What is the likely timeline for resolving my consumer protection case?
- How much can I receive in damages for my consumer protection lawsuit?
